Gremlins Quote by Donald O. Clifton
““But not unlike the gremlins in the film of the same name who were transformed into nasty little critters if they were splashed or if they were fed after midnight, irrelevant nontalents can mutate into real weaknesses under one condition: As soon as you find yourself in a role that requires you to play to one of your nontalents-or area of low skills or knowledge-a weakness is born.””
About This Quote
Source Book: StrengthsFinder 2.0 by Tom Rath, 2007
When you are placed in a role that highlights your weakest skills, those gaps become pronounced weaknesses.
In simple terms: Weak spots become real when you must use them.
Avoid roles that expose low‑skill areas.
